While the CTD fluorescence data are expressed in concentration units, they do not always compare well to extracted chlorophyll samples, particularly for casts far from shore. There was no salinity, pH or dissolved oxygen calibration sampling and no other information available upon which to base a recalibration. WARNING: The pH:SBE:Nominal data should be used with caution; no field calibration data are available. Calibration is required for each cast to get absolute values, although general trends within a cast are likely real.
